Brexit Transition: Tax Account Setup Changes (except SuiteTax)
This notice is intended for NetSuite Accounts that have a United Kingdom (UK) subsidiary or a European Union (EU) subsidiary.
NetSuite SuiteAnswers will shortly include a Brexit training recording, which will be followed by a customer webinar in January 2021.
What is Changing?
The Brexit transition period ends this year. This means the UK will leave the European Union VAT regime, Customs Union, and the Single Market on December 31, 2020.
